Product reviews:
HEXBUG BATTLE SPIDER BATTLE GROUND hexbug battle spider battle ground
hexbug battle spider battle ground
Ingemar
2025-12-03 iphone 7
Spider Hexbug Battle Spiders Review hexbug battle spider battle ground
hexbug battle spider battle ground
Spencer
2025-11-26 iphone 7 Plus
Hexbug Battle Ground Tower – Review hexbug battle spider battle ground
hexbug battle spider battle ground
Patrick
2025-11-28 iphone X
HexBug Battle Spiders | Laser Robot hexbug battle spider battle ground
hexbug battle spider battle ground